

Birth: Oct 1, 1932. Hue, Vietnam.
Death: Feb 7, 2021. California, USA.
Occupation: Nurse, Midwife
"Raising a child is like watching a flower grow." - Thanh-Lieu Tran
In Vietnam, she was the Director of a National Midwife Education Program, where she trained and graduated nurses.
She immigrated to the US with her family in 1975, and was among the first Vietnamese refugees to settle in Orange County, CA. In the US, she continued her nursing career until her retirement.
She proudly traveled worldwide to represent her Vietnamese Midwife Nursing Industry. She loved visiting her younger siblings in France and Switzerland. And she enjoyed growing orchids in California with her family, friends, and former students. She spoke 4 languages: Vietnamese, French, English, and Spanish.
She is survived by her son, Anh; daughter-in-law, Nicole; grand-daughter, Andie; her sisters & brother; and many nieces & nephews.
